Alexandria Real Estate Equities Inc Cash Flow-to-Debt Ratio (1996–2025)

Annual Cash Flow-to-Debt Ratio for Alexandria Real Estate Equities Inc (1996–2025)

Year CF-to-Debt Ratio Operating CF (USD) Total Liabilities YoY Change
2025 0.09x $1.41 Billion $14.93 Billion ▼ -4.7%
2024 0.10x $1.50 Billion $15.13 Billion ▼ -13.7%
2023 0.12x $1.63 Billion $14.15 Billion ▲ +14.3%
2022 0.10x $1.29 Billion $12.84 Billion ▲ +11.6%
2021 0.09x $1.01 Billion $11.19 Billion ▼ -4.0%
2020 0.09x $882.51 Million $9.38 Billion ▲ +13.1%
2019 0.08x $683.86 Million $8.22 Billion ▼ -4.2%
2018 0.09x $570.34 Million $6.57 Billion ▲ +8.3%
2017 0.08x $450.32 Million $5.62 Billion ▲ +1.5%
2016 0.08x $392.50 Million $4.97 Billion ▲ +6.4%
2015 0.07x $342.61 Million $4.62 Billion ▼ -6.2%
2014 0.08x $334.32 Million $4.23 Billion ▼ -10.2%
2013 0.09x $312.73 Million $3.55 Billion ▲ +5.1%
2012 0.08x $305.53 Million $3.65 Billion ▲ +6.6%
2011 0.08x $246.96 Million $3.14 Billion ▲ +4.6%
2010 0.08x $219.35 Million $2.92 Billion ▲ +12.8%
2009 0.07x $205.95 Million $3.09 Billion ▼ -3.1%
2008 0.07x $232.71 Million $3.39 Billion ▲ +13.6%
2007 0.06x $185.38 Million $3.06 Billion ▲ +4.1%
2006 0.06x $128.39 Million $2.21 Billion ▼ -27.1%
2005 0.08x $120.68 Million $1.51 Billion ▲ +47.4%
2004 0.05x $67.75 Million $1.25 Billion ▼ -44.6%
2003 0.10x $74.85 Million $765.44 Million ▼ -1.8%
2002 0.10x $67.05 Million $673.39 Million ▲ +3.9%
2001 0.10x $60.34 Million $629.51 Million ▲ +34.4%
2000 0.07x $32.93 Million $461.83 Million ▼ -35.9%
1999 0.11x $42.30 Million $380.50 Million ▲ +40.8%
1998 0.08x $26.10 Million $330.50 Million ▲ +65.2%
1997 0.05x $3.90 Million $81.60 Million ▲ +460.8%
1996 -0.01x $-1.60 Million $120.80 Million
Cash Flow-to-Debt Ratio = Operating Cash Flow / Total Liabilities. Higher is better for debt service capacity.
